Before opening his parachute, the velocity should not decrease for the parachutist. 5 B Distance travelled from t = 20 s to t = 50 s = area under the graph = (½ x 20 x (12.0 + 16.0)) + (½ x 10 x 12.0) = 340 m. Average speed = total distance / total time = 340 / 30 = 11.333…. = 11 m / s (2 s.f.) 6 A There are no action-reaction pair as all the forces are acting on the same ladder. 7 D The block of wood is moving to the left. Hence forces acting towards the left is positive. First 5.0 s: Using “F = ma”, since a = 0 m / s2, net force = 0 N Thus, there must be friction of 20 N acting on the wood. After 5.0 s: Net force = F = F1 – friction – F2 = 20 N – 20 N – 10N = - 10 N (this means the net force is acting to the right, opposite to the motion of the wood) From “F = ma”, ‘a’ is negative when net force F is negative. Negative ‘a’ means deceleration. 30 N South 30 N West Combined effect of 2 horizontal forces = 30 N West Together with the 30 N South force, the resultant force is acting approximately in the South-West direction. Hence to keep the mass in equilibrium, an additional force with the same magnitude as the resultant force acting in the opposite direction to the resultant force is required. Resultant force South-West Additional force North-East
8 C Using “ ρ = m / V ” V of each ball bearing = m / ρ = 18.0 / 9.0 = 2.0 cm3 V of eight steel balls = 2.0 x 8 = 16.0 cm3 Reading on measuring cylinder = 25.0 + 16.0 = 41.0 cm3 9 D d4 is perpendicular to the line of action of the force F. 10 D Diagram Taking moments about K, sum of clockwise moments = sum of anti-clockwise moments (11.0 x 3.0) + (11.0 x 1.2) = (12.0 x d) + (10.0 x 1.5) d = 31.2 / 12.0 = 2.6 m 11 C Pressure in the mercury column increases with depth.
